Leafline's drift-correction job recalibrates humidity and temperature sensors hourly against reference probes. It runs under the svc-leafline-drift service account, which authenticates to the Canopy internal calibration API. Reviewers: confirm the account has calibration:write only — broader scopes get flagged at audit. Drift offsets are logged per sensor; anything above 2% triggers a recalibration pass. Key rotation is quarterly and owned by the platform team. The current service-account key is recorded directly below.

gateway credential: kto3_qfe

## Deploy step 4: order-cutoff rule

This change moves the Crumbside bakery order-cutoff from a hardcoded 14:00 to a per-store setting, defaulting to 14:00. Reviewer: confirm the migration backfills existing stores and that the cutoff check runs against store-local time, not server time. Orders placed exactly at the cutoff are accepted. Once approved, the deploy bundle must be signed before the pipeline will pick it up. The deploy key used to sign the bundle appears below.

signing key of yajog-kafof = bky19_orbYRY3Abj3KpZesMie

Handover note — Crumbwheel order cutoffs.

Welcome aboard. The bakery cutoff rule in Crumbwheel closes same-day orders at 14:00 local to each storefront, not UTC — this has bitten us twice. Holiday overrides live in the calendar service and take precedence silently, so always check there first when a cutoff looks wrong. To unlock the calendar service's admin console after a restart, enter the recovery passphrase below.

vault phrase of bagap-bahaf = silion-pelox-sorox-casdor-quenwyn-fraax-eliox-praael-kelion-quenvan-kasox-rusael-norius-belvan

Handover for RateMirror, our hotel rate-parity checker. The scraper pool runs nightly against the Quillhaven and Bexley Grand test properties; parity diffs land in the morning digest. Flaky selectors are the usual culprit when numbers look off. Talk to Priya on the Fenwick team before touching the comparison thresholds. The full architecture notes and deploy steps live on the internal wiki page here:

runbook for yadup-tagug: https://jira.tolvaqlabs.internal/browse/projects/projects/browse